My current project involves writing perl code inside a Solaris VMWare appliance (hosted on a Mac).
In order to use the CPAN, I need to install a version of "make" inside the VM.
What is the most frugal apprach (disk space and download capacity are limited...

Check in /usr/ccs/bin for the make included with Solaris, if you installed at least the "Developer" level install choice/package cluster .
The sunfreeware site has a prebuilt version of GNU Make 3.81 for Solaris 9 - that is probably your best best .
